Question of the day

If a woman experiences syncope during vaginal bleeding, what should the EMT conclude?

Explanation:
When a woman experiences syncope, or fainting, during vaginal bleeding, it is a critical sign that may indicate a drop in blood volume or perfusion to the brain. Syncope can result from various causes related to the condition of the patient, but in the context of vaginal bleeding, it strongly suggests that the woman may be in a state of shock. Shock occurs when there is inadequate blood flow to the body's organs, often due to significant blood loss. If the woman is bleeding heavily, this loss of blood can lead to decreased circulating volume, resulting in symptoms like dizziness, fainting, or confusion. The EMT should prioritize assessing the woman's vital signs and the extent of her bleeding, as these indicators are crucial for determining her condition and guiding the necessary interventions. While other options may imply serious conditions (such as pregnancy issues or infection), syncope in the context of significant vaginal bleeding primarily points towards shock as the most immediate and critical concern requiring prompt medical attention.
